The End of the NPSP? Salesforce Embarks on a New Nonprofit Journey

About this event

Salesforce announced on March 14 that it would begin delivering new innovations for nonprofit focused products through an entirely new solution under the Nonprofit Cloud name. What does this mean for new features and support of the NPSP? What should existing and new organizations consider as they’re hearing this news? Join us for details and a community discussion lead by 10x Salesforce MVP Ryan Ozimek from Soapbox Engage.
